Subject: Responsibility change — Stagelight seat-map renderer

Hi, as you review the upcoming patches to the Aldermere Playhouse seat-map renderer, note that ownership has shifted. The SVG layout engine, the accessibility overlay, and the zoom-level caching all now fall under one person rather than the old rotation. Please route review questions, especially anything touching the balcony-tier geometry code, to the new owner directly. Their name is below for your records.

named custodian: Ulaix Wenwyn

Minutes — Management Meeting, Quillbrook Instruments

Attendees: R. Haskin, P. Omero, L. Vance. Topic: revised sales-commission scheme effective next quarter. Base commission moves from 4% to 3.5%, offset by a 6% accelerator on sales above quota. Renewals now count at half weight; new-logo deals at full weight. Haskin confirmed payout caps are removed for the Easterly region pilot. Vance will circulate updated calculators to all sales leads by month end. Objections due in writing within ten days. One confidential item was recorded below.

board note of fahap-yafop: Headcount on the Istion team goes from 50 to 73 by the end of September. Gross margin on Istion came in at 33 percent against a plan of 28 percent.

## Deployment

The Quillrot secrets-rotation utility runs as a scheduled job on the Harfield cluster. Support staff deploying a new build should first drain the active rotation queue, then apply the manifest from the `deploy/` directory and confirm the health probe reports ready. Rollbacks are safe at any point before the commit phase; after commit, rotated secrets cannot be restored automatically, so escalate to the on-call owner instead. Before restarting the job, always confirm the environment matches the values shown below.

service settings:
PRAIX_LOG_LEVEL=error
PRAIX_METRICS_HOST=metrics.praix.qorvelcorp.corp
PRAIX_POOL_SIZE=16